Come and take it. The phrase emanates power and instantly places images of courage, character, and a refusal to quit, regardless of circumstance. It is the warrior's rally cry. Thermopylae. The Battle of Fort Morris during the Revolutionary War in 1778. The Battle of Gonzalez which started the Texas Revolution for Independence from Mexico in 1835. Each event had the same story. An overwhelming force stood in front of a small band of men. Men who should have known only fear, men who had no chance of victory, men who common sense demanded should comply and told them to lay down their arms and surrender. But these men understood that to lay down one's arms, to remove one's ability to defend himself, is an implicit dissolution of freedom.
